## Run Jupyter Lab on a local Machine (Laptop, Desktop)
Prerequisites: Miniconda3 (light-weight, preferred) or Anaconda3 and Mamba

* Install [Miniconda3](https://docs.conda.io/en/latest/miniconda.html)
* Install Mamba: ```conda install mamba -n base -c conda-forge```
------

1. Clone this git repository

```
git clone https://github.com/jupyter-guide/ten-rules-jupyter.git
```

2. Change into the directory

```
cd ten-rules-jupyter
```

3. Create CONDA environment

```
mamba env create -f environment.yml
```
4. Activate the CONDA environment

```
conda activate ten-rules-jupyter
```
5. Launch Jupyter Lab

```
jupyter lab
```

6. Deactivate the CONDA environment

```
conda deactivate
```
